3. 10-Minute Berry Almond Crumble

When looking for Healthy Dessert Recipes, fruit based options are incredibly refreshing, especially when they are served warm with a golden, crumbly topping. This berry almond crumble is entirely foolproof and looks like it took hours to assemble.
Instead of a traditional butter and white flour crumble, you are going to use almond flour, rolled oats, and a splash of coconut oil. Toss some frozen mixed berries into a beautiful ramekin, sprinkle your oat mixture on top, and pop it in the oven (or even your air fryer!). The natural juices bubble up and create a sweet, sticky syrup that pairs perfectly with the nutty crunch of the topping.
Simple Steps:
- Add 1 cup of frozen berries directly to a small baking dish.
- Mix 1/2 cup oats, 1/4 cup almond flour, 2 tbsp maple syrup, and 1 tbsp melted coconut oil in a small bowl.
- Sprinkle over the berries and bake at 350°F (175°C) for 15 minutes until bubbling.

5. Elegant Greek Yogurt Cheesecake Jars

When brainstorming Healthy Dessert Recipes ideas to serve at a dinner party or family gathering, you want something that looks sophisticated but doesn’t require a water bath or a springform pan. Enter: individual Greek yogurt cheesecake jars.
By using full-fat Greek yogurt mixed with a little cream cheese and vanilla bean paste, you get a tangy, rich filling packed with protein. Layer it in small glass jars with crushed graham crackers or almond flour, and top with fresh fruit. It looks like you bought it from a high-end patisserie, but you made it in your pajamas in 10 minutes flat.
Layering Guide for Perfection:
- The Base: Crushed pecans and a tiny drizzle of honey.
- The Middle: Whipped Greek yogurt, cream cheese, and vanilla bean paste.
- The Top: Fresh raspberries and a sprig of fresh mint.

6. Smart Ingredient Swaps That Actually Taste Good
To truly make desserts that fit your busy life, you don’t need to reinvent the wheel. You just need to know how to swap out traditional baking ingredients for healthier, whole-food alternatives.
The chart below is your ultimate cheat-sheet to bypass baking anxiety. These simple, 1:1 style swaps upgrade the nutritional value of any healthy dessert recipe instantly without sacrificing that decadent, melt-in-your-mouth flavor we love.

| Traditional Ingredient | Smarter, Whole-Food Swap | Why It Works |
| White Refined Sugar | Ripe mashed banana or pure maple syrup | Adds natural moisture and a richer flavor depth. |
| Unsalted Butter | Full-fat Greek yogurt or coconut oil | Keeps things incredibly moist while adding protein or healthy fats. |
| Heavy Cream | Canned coconut milk or cashew cream | Delivers that signature silky mouthfeel completely dairy-free. |
| All-Purpose Flour | Oat flour or almond flour | Adds a lovely, warm, nutty flavor and a major fiber boost. |
| Milk Chocolate Chips | 70%+ Dark chocolate chunks | Offers a deeper cacao flavor with significantly less sugar. |
